Ram-Nagar Gram Panchayat, Badla Pur
Ram-Nagar is a Gram Panchayat located in the Jaunpur district of Uttar Pradesh. It falls under the Badla Pur Kshettra Panchayat and Jaunpur Zila Panchayat. Ram-Nagar Gram Panchayat covers a single village, Ram Nagar. It is headed by an elected Gram Pradhan, while administrative work is handled by the Gram Panchayat Adhikari.

Panchayati Raj Structure for Ram-Nagar Gram Panchayat
Ram-Nagar Gram Panchayat is part of Uttar Pradesh's three-tier Panchayati Raj structure. The three levels are described below.
Tier 1: Gram Panchayat (GP)
Ram-Nagar Gram Panchayat is the village-level Panchayati Raj institution. It handles local development and basic civic services such as drinking water, sanitation, street lighting and village infrastructure.
Tier 2: Block Panchayat (BP)
Badla Pur Kshettra Panchayat is the intermediate-level Panchayati Raj institution for Ram-Nagar Gram Panchayat. It coordinates development activities across Gram Panchayats in its area.
Tier 3: District Panchayat (DP)
Jaunpur Zila Panchayat is the district-level Panchayati Raj institution for Ram-Nagar Gram Panchayat. It coordinates development planning and activities at the district level.
